What is the Growth Strategy and Future Prospects of D.R. Horton?

D.R. Horton, America's largest homebuilder since 2002, began in 1978 with a vision for affordable housing. Starting with just $500,000, the company has grown into a multi-billion dollar enterprise.

What is Growth Strategy and Future Prospects of D.R. Horton Company?

Operating in 126 markets across 36 states, the company closed over 93,000 homes in fiscal year 2024, generating $36.8 billion in revenue and $4.76 billion in net income. This remarkable expansion highlights its strategic focus on entry-level and move-up housing segments.

Despite market challenges in 2025, including interest rate fluctuations, D.R. How Is D.R. Horton Expanding Its Reach?

D.R. Horton's expansion is built on a disciplined approach to land acquisition and a wide-reaching operational presence. The company operates in 126 markets across 36 states, demonstrating a significant geographic footprint.

Icon Land Control Strategy

The company utilizes an 'asset-light' land control model. As of March 31, 2025, approximately 76% of its 640,000-lot pipeline is controlled via options, minimizing capital outlay and enhancing flexibility.

Icon Geographic Focus and Diversification

Strategic investments are made in regions with robust demographic trends, particularly Texas and the Southeast. This diversification helps mitigate potential downturns in other markets.

Icon Community Growth and Product Affordability

D.R. Horton continues to increase its community count, which grew by 12% year-over-year. The focus on affordable products, like those offered by the Express Homes brand, targets entry-level buyers and expands customer reach.

Icon Customer Acquisition and Market Presence

Incentives such as mortgage rate buydowns and closing cost assistance are key to attracting first-time buyers, who represented 64% of closings in Q3 2025. The company's dual listing on the NYSE Texas aims to broaden its market presence and investor accessibility.

What Is D.R. Horton’s Growth Forecast?

D.R. Horton's financial performance in fiscal 2025 indicates a period of adjustment within the real estate sector. The company is navigating market dynamics while maintaining a focus on its core operations and shareholder value.

Icon Q1 Fiscal 2025 Performance

For the first fiscal quarter ended December 31, 2024, D.R. Horton reported consolidated revenues of $7.6 billion. Net income attributable to the company was $844.9 million, translating to $2.61 per diluted share.

Icon Q2 Fiscal 2025 Performance

In the second fiscal quarter ended March 31, 2025, consolidated revenues stood at $7.7 billion. Net income for this period was $810.4 million, or $2.58 per diluted share.

Icon Q3 Fiscal 2025 Performance

The third fiscal quarter ended June 30, 2025, saw consolidated revenues of $9.2 billion. Net income for Q3 fiscal 2025 reached $1.0 billion, or $3.36 per diluted share.

Icon Full Year Fiscal 2025 Guidance

The company projects full-year fiscal 2025 consolidated revenues between $33.7 billion and $34.2 billion, with homes closed anticipated to be between 85,000 and 85,500 units.

D.R. Horton's financial outlook for fiscal year 2025 demonstrates a strategic approach to managing its business amidst evolving market conditions. The company's guidance reflects its operational capacity and commitment to financial health, aligning with its broader D.R. Horton growth strategy.

Icon

Home Sales Gross Margin

For the fourth fiscal quarter of 2025, the company anticipates a home sales gross margin in the range of 21.0% to 21.5%.

Icon

Consolidated Pre-Tax Profit Margin

The projected consolidated pre-tax profit margin for Q4 fiscal 2025 is expected to be between 13.6% and 14.1%.

Icon

Cash Flow from Operations

D.R. Horton projects consolidated cash flow provided by operations to exceed $3.0 billion for the entirety of fiscal 2025.

Icon

Share Repurchases and Dividends

The company plans significant shareholder returns, with share repurchases anticipated between $4.2 billion and $4.4 billion, and dividend payments around $500 million for fiscal 2025.

Icon

Return on Equity and Assets

For the trailing twelve months ending June 30, 2025, the company achieved a return on equity (ROE) of 16.1% and a return on assets (ROA) of 11.1%.

Icon

Comparison to Fiscal 2024

These fiscal 2025 projections are compared to fiscal 2024 results, which included $36.8 billion in revenue and 89,690 homes closed, highlighting the current market's impact on the homebuilder growth strategy.

What Risks Could Slow D.R. Horton’s Growth?

The company's growth strategy faces several potential risks and obstacles within the current economic climate. Rising mortgage rates and persistent affordability challenges, coupled with broader economic uncertainty, create significant headwinds that could dampen sales volumes and affect profit margins.

Icon

Economic Headwinds

Rising mortgage rates and general economic uncertainty pose a significant threat to sales volume and profit margins. Affordability issues continue to be a major concern for potential homebuyers.

Icon

Reduced Order Backlog

A reported decrease in the sales order backlog by -21.00% indicates a potential constraint on future revenue generation. This trend suggests a need for proactive sales and marketing efforts.

Icon

Intensified Competition

The homebuilding sector is highly competitive, with key players like Lennar and PulteGroup vying for market share. D.R. Horton must continually differentiate its pricing and product offerings to maintain its competitive edge.

Icon

Supply Chain and Input Costs

Vulnerabilities in the supply chain and rising input costs, such as increased labor rates and potential tariff impacts like a 34.5% hike on Canadian softwood lumber, continue to pressure profitability.

Icon

Regional Demand Variability

Fluctuations in regional demand, often influenced by local policies and economic conditions, present another challenge. Adapting to these localized market shifts is crucial for sustained growth.

Icon

Financial Flexibility

Despite these challenges, the company maintains a strong financial position with total liquidity of $5.5 billion as of June 30, 2025, including $2.6 billion in cash and $2.9 billion in credit facilities.

To navigate these potential pitfalls, the company leverages a disciplined capital allocation strategy and a robust balance sheet, evidenced by a low debt to total capital ratio of 23.2% as of June 30, 2025. This financial strength provides considerable flexibility to adapt to evolving market dynamics. Furthermore, its asset-light land strategy, where a significant portion of its lot pipeline is under option, minimizes capital intensity and allows for agile adjustments to market shifts. The company also actively employs sales incentives and strategically reduces base home prices to enhance affordability and sustain sales momentum.
